Google Earth 2.0 for iPhone now in the AppStore

mymap Google Earth, the most popular application from Google, and one of the most popular in the AppStore, introduced more than a year ago, was updated yesterday to version 2.0. The big novelty that this version brings is My Maps. But what is My Maps? For those who don't know, My Maps is the option given by Google to people who want to create personalized maps when they go on a trip, maps that can be customized by the user to include points of interest, marking locations on the map where they want to go, friends' houses, restaurants, hotels they could go to, places visited by others, just about everything that could cross a person's mind. Starting yesterday, Google, by updating Google Earth, introduced the possibility for users to use these maps directly from the iPhone through the application, accessing the Google Maps account directly from the phone. The maps can be made using the Google Earth PC application, then uploaded to the Google Maps account, after which they can also be used on the phone.
